Just got finished installing the new axle on my 200X. Looks great. Was a good experience to learn how the axle disassembles, bearings go on, hub, rotor, etc come together. Only tricky part was removing the bearing spacer from the old axle and getting it onto the new one. It was a little rusty, and was tight on the new axle. I cleaned it thoroughly after using sandpaper on the inside to remove the rust, and put some synthetic grease inside it to keep it from seizing on again. Before and after pictures to install.

Also installed a CR85 front caliper on the rear to replace the messed up one that came with my trike. Easy install, and nice to have new pads and pins that came with the new caliper.

I"m the one that figured out the cr80 swap on the 200x that Grizzlypeg did. You can also use a kx80 rear one for the front. Just have to reuse either 200x steel bracket.

thebutelr --- the caliper swap will work on your 350x just reuse your original bracket.
